Purpose and legal basis
We process your personal data for the following purposes:
- Contact and delivery of our services: performance of a contract or steps taken prior to entering into a contract (Article 6(1)(b)).
- Maturity assessment and booking: your consent (Article 6(1)(a)).
- Newsletter: your consent (Article 6(1)(a)).
- AI-generated summary of your company based on your enquiry: our legitimate interest in preparing a relevant conversation (Article 6(1)(f)). Read more in our AI Policy.
- Documenting meetings and correspondence in a customer relationship: performance of the agreement (Article 6(1)(b)) and our legitimate interest in being able to document what was agreed (Article 6(1)(f)).
- Operation, security and server logs: our legitimate interest in a secure and well-functioning website (Article 6(1)(f)).
- Bookkeeping in customer relationships: a legal obligation (Article 6(1)(c)).

Retention
| Data | Retention | Basis |
|---|---|---|
| Accounting and invoicing data in customer relationships | 5 years after the end of the financial year | Section 12 of the Danish Bookkeeping Act (statutory requirement) |
| Leads, bookings and maturity-assessment answers without a subsequent customer relationship | Deleted or anonymised after 24 months of inactivity | Legitimate interest (housekeeping) |
| Contact enquiries (email) | 24 months after the matter is closed | Legitimate interest |
| Transcripts of the spoken record of recorded meetings | Deleted 24 months after the meeting. The summary, subject, date and participant list are kept as the business record | Legitimate interest |
| Newsletter subscription | Until you unsubscribe | Consent |
Your rights
Under the General Data Protection Regulation you have the right to obtain access to the data we hold about you, to have it rectified or erased, to have the processing restricted, to object to the processing, and to receive your data in a structured, commonly used and machine-readable format (data portability). Where processing is based on consent, you may withdraw that consent at any time. This does not affect the lawfulness of processing carried out before the withdrawal.
